We had the best time trying all the incredible Gaziantep foods!! This city really surprised us in the best possible way. We tried so many different Gaziantep foods, so many new and different flavors and the best baklava in the world!!! For real!!
These all the Gaziantep foods we tried during our DIY food tour: (key moments)
1. Katmer - From 00:00 - 03:10
2. Baklava - From 03:13
3. Dibek Coffee - From 04:38
4. Beyran - From 05:57
5. Simit Kebap & Patlican - From 07:43
6. More Baklava - From 10:24
7. Chicken Doner - From 11:18
8. Ali Nazik Kebap - From 12:27
9. Menengic Coffee - From 15:05
10. Room Service (Healthy Food 😂) From - 16:22
11. Final Thoughts Gaziantep - From 17:02
